Dublin / London: Dolmen Press / Oxford University Press, 1965. Limited Edition. Hardcover. Very Good+/Very Good+. Brown paper over boards, backed in gilt-stamped parchment, gilt-stamped monogram on upper board; glassine dust jacket; publisher's slipcase; 8vo; pp. 46, [1] (limitation page), printed in red and black, and reproducing 14 photographs. Number 364 from a limited edition of 1250 copies. Spine tips lightly rubbed; spot of soiling at fore-edge of half-title page (perhaps a coffee stain). Dust jacket lightly chipped along top edge. Slipcase a little bumped and dust-soiled.
